But as Mark Twain said in his own sarcastic way “man is a religious animal.” I assume he was referring to the fact that sooner or later, it dawns on people that there must be something or someone bigger than themselves in this universe. Seventeenth century thinker Blaise Pascal wrote about this and it has been paraphrased as people having a “God Sized Hole” in their being that we often try to fill with other things – but we will not be satisfied until we fill ourselves with God. Who is this God? What is God like?  How may we get to know this God?

Christian Theologians study the Bible to discover how God has revealed Himself to us. They refer to what can be known of God as “Attributes.” The list of attributes may vary between theologians, but the list usually includes – God is: Self-Existent, Eternal, Omnipotent, Omniscient, Omnipresent, Sovereign, Transcendent, Immanent, Immutable, Righteous, Just, Holy, Loving, Merciful, Gracious, and True.
